Ghrelin is an endogenous orexigenic hormone mainly produced by stomach cells and is reported to influence appetite, gastrointestinal motility and growth hormone secretion. We observed that enzymatic digest of wheat gluten stimulated ghrelin secretion from mouse ghrelinoma 3‐1, a ghrelin‐releasing cell line. Further on, we characterized the ghrelin‐releasing peptides present in the digest by comprehensive peptide analysis using liquid chromatography–mass spectrometry and structure–activity relationship. Among the candidate peptides, we found that SQQQQPVLPQQPSF, LSVTSPQQVSY and YPTSL stimulated ghrelin release. We then named them wheat‐ghretropin A, B and C, respectively. In addition, we observed that wheat‐ghretropin A increased plasma ghrelin concentration and food intake in mice after oral administration. Thus, we demonstrated that wheat‐ghretropin stimulates ghrelin release both in vitro and in vivo. To the best of our knowledge, this is the first report of a wheat‐derived exogenous bioactive peptide that stimulates ghrelin secretion.
